随着互联网的普及,网络安全问题日益凸显。安全漏洞不仅可能导致个人信息泄露,还可能对企业和国家造成严重的经济损失。为了帮助用户解决安全漏洞问题,自动修复工具应运而生。本文将深入探讨自动修复工具的工作原理、应用场景以及如何选择合适的工具,以帮助用户安心上网。
自动修复工具的工作原理
1. 漏洞扫描
自动修复工具首先会进行漏洞扫描,通过检测操作系统、应用程序、网络设备等是否存在已知的安全漏洞。这一过程通常包括以下步骤:
- 静态分析:对代码进行静态分析,查找潜在的安全漏洞。
- 动态分析:在程序运行时进行检测,观察程序的行为是否安全。
- 网络扫描:检测网络连接中的潜在风险。
2. 漏洞识别
在漏洞扫描的基础上,自动修复工具会识别出具体的安全漏洞。常见的漏洞类型包括:
- SQL注入:通过在数据库查询中插入恶意代码,获取数据库中的敏感信息。
- 跨站脚本攻击(XSS):通过在网页中注入恶意脚本,盗取用户信息。
- 远程代码执行(RCE):允许攻击者远程执行代码,控制受感染的系统。
3. 自动修复
识别出漏洞后,自动修复工具会根据漏洞类型和修复方案,自动进行修复操作。修复方式可能包括:
- 打补丁:为操作系统或应用程序安装最新的安全补丁。
- 修改配置:调整系统或应用程序的配置,以降低安全风险。
- 禁用功能:禁用可能导致安全漏洞的功能。
自动修复工具的应用场景
1. 个人用户
对于个人用户来说,自动修复工具可以帮助:
- 保护个人信息:防止恶意软件窃取个人信息。
- 避免经济损失:减少因安全漏洞导致的财产损失。
- 提高上网体验:确保上网环境的安全,提高上网体验。
2. 企业用户
对于企业用户来说,自动修复工具可以帮助:
- 降低安全风险:确保企业信息系统安全稳定运行。
- 提高工作效率:自动化修复操作,节省人力成本。
- 符合合规要求:满足国家相关网络安全法律法规的要求。
如何选择合适的自动修复工具
1. 功能全面
选择自动修复工具时,应考虑其功能是否全面。一个优秀的工具应具备以下功能:
- 漏洞扫描:能够全面扫描各种安全漏洞。
- 漏洞识别:能够准确识别出已知的安全漏洞。
- 自动修复:能够根据漏洞类型自动进行修复操作。
2. 易用性
自动修复工具应具备良好的易用性,方便用户操作。以下因素可考虑:
- 界面友好:界面简洁,操作方便。
- 文档齐全:提供详细的操作指南和帮助文档。
- 技术支持:提供及时的技术支持和售后服务。
3. 安全性
选择自动修复工具时,应确保其本身的安全性。以下因素可考虑:
- 代码质量:代码经过严格审查,不存在安全漏洞。
- 数据加密:对用户数据进行加密处理,确保数据安全。
- 更新频率:定期更新漏洞库,确保修复方案的有效性。
总结
自动修复工具在解决安全漏洞方面发挥着重要作用。通过选择合适的工具,用户可以轻松解决安全漏洞问题,享受安全、便捷的上网体验。未来,随着网络安全形势的日益严峻,自动修复工具的应用将越来越广泛。
